16 Fun Facts About Mary Tyler Moore

Originally, the character of Mary Richards on The Mary Tyler Moore Show was supposed to be a divorcee; however, CBS network researchers shut down the idea as viewers didn’t want “divorced women” in their living rooms.

mary tyler moore GIF by HULU

Moore got her start acting in TV commercials. She was the mascot for Hotpoint Appliances when she was just 17 years old. She filmed 39 commercials for them in just 5 days.

Image result for Hotpoint Appliances, mary tyler moore

For one of her big TV roles, Moore played a receptionist in six episodes of Richard Diamond, Private Detective. The show only featured her voice and legs.

Image result for Richard Diamond, Private Detective secretary, mary tyler moore

Moore was also a model for various LP covers.

Image result for lp covers, mary tyler moore

When Moore was cast as Laura Petrie in The Dick Van Dyke Show, producers wanted her to be the next June Cleaver. However, Moore insisted on wearing comfortable capri pants because she felt that it was a more realistic representation of the modern housewife.

Rip Tyler GIF

The Mary Tyler Moore Show was one of the first shows ever to celebrate an independent career woman. It won 29 Emmy Awards throughout its run.

Mary Tyler Moore GIF

After seven seasons, The Mary Tyler Moore Show decided to end while it was still performing strongly in the ratings. It was one of the rare series finales that allowed the characters to break character and bid farewell to one another in the context of the show. Moore also introduced each of her cast mates to the audience for a final curtain call before the end credits rolled.

Sad Mary Tyler Moore GIF

To play homage to her character, there is a statue of Mary Richards tossing her cap into the air on Nicollet Mall in Minneapolis, the site of her series’ iconic opening credits sequence.

Image result for mary tyler moore statue

The Mary Tyler Moore Show had an unprecedented number of female writers. Of the 75 contributing writers that made up the staff, 25 were women.

mary tyler moore journalist GIF by HULU

The costume designer for The Mary Tyler Moore Show also built Mary’s wardrobe with clothes that women could actually buy. She sourced clothes from one retailer, that way Mary could mix and match separates that any woman could actually go out and purchase.

Mary Tyler Moore 1970S GIF

Tina Fey’s comedy 30 Rock is said to be somewhat of a reboot of The Mary Tyler Moore Show. The characters in 30 Rock are uncanny parallels of the cast of Moore’s show: Liz Lemon (Mary Richards), Jack Donaghy (Lou Grant), Tracy Jordan (Ted Baxter), Pete Hornberger (Murray Slaughter, and Jenna Maroney (Sue Ann Nivens).

Image result for mary tyler moore,30 rock

The series finale of Friends also borrowed the same format as the ending of The Mary Tyler Moore Show.

Image result for friends series finale, mary tyler moore show series finaleImage result for friends series finale, mary tyler moore show series finale

Moore was a strong advocate against Diabetes. She was diagnosed with Type 1 Diabetes at the age of 33 and testified before Congress to promote stem-cell research as a way of curing the illness.

Image result for mary tyler moore, diabetes

The beret that Moore tosses in the opening credits of The Mary Tyler Moore Show was actually a gift from Moore’s aunt. She wore it to the shoot (it was super cold that day) and one of the writers told her to “take the hat, the beret, and throw it in the air.”

Mary Tyler Moore Hooray GIF

In 1980, Moore’s son Richie Meeker accidentally shot himself and died. That same year, Moore starred in the movie, Ordinary People, as a woman whose son almost kills himself and another who dies in an accident. She said she took the role as a way to deal with the real life tragedy of her own son, Richie.

Image result for richie meeker

Because The Mary Tyler Moore Show was so successful in promoting women’s rights, First Lady Betty Food actually appeared on one episode of the show.

13 Ways to Read More in 2018

Most people who love reading want to make time to read more every year. With more and more books hitting the shelves, it’s become near impossible to keep up with all the must-read titles; however, you can make it easier to read more this year…and more of what you like…with this helpful list of 13 ways to read more in 2018. From starting a journal to joining a book club, this list of ideas will turn you into an adorkable bookworm in no time!

read-more-in-2018

Set a realistic number of how many books you want to read this year.

books GIF

Sure we’d all like to read all the best-sellers this year, but many of us just don’t have the time. Start with a goal of 12 (one a month) and see how it goes. You also know yourself best, so if you’re more likely to take longer to finish a book, set a goal of 6. Best case you exceed it!

Make reading part of your daily routine.

Read Harry Potter GIF

Whether you read before bed or on your lunch break, work it into your schedule. Set aside a certain amount of time or commit to reading a certain amount of pages every day to help you power through.

Create a cozy reading environment at home.

Cozy Sarah Chalke GIF by HULU

Take some time to create a cozy reading nook. Arrange your bookshelves or get a comfy chair and blanket to help make reading more comfortable.

Get a freaking library card.

Read Beauty And The Beast GIF by Disney

Take a walk through any Barnes and Nobel and you’ll realize how expensive a new book can be…why fork out 30 bucks for a book you could get for free?! If your local library doesn’t carry the title you’re looking for, most will order it for you from another library…FOR FREE. In most states, you can also use your library card at any library state-wide. Some libraries even give perks to their members, like renting eBooks for free and discounted tickets to other events in the area.

Throw a book in your bag.

Image result for book in bag

Sometimes it’s those little moments when you can get the most reading done…while you’re waiting for your train or your lunch to be made. If you buy your book online, you can often get a digital version as well, so even if you can’t carry the physical book, you can keep up with your reading on your phone or eReader.

AUDIOBOOKS.

Image result for audiobooks

This is a no-brainer. Listening to audiobooks is a great way to keep up with your reading. You can listen in the car, when you work out, even when you’re working (if you can handle someone talking in your ear!). There are several subscription sites where you can listen to eBooks online, and libraries often have a great selection of books on CD if your car has a CD player.

Join a book club.

Image result for book club

Or start one of your own! Chances are after you finish a book, you’re going to want to talk about it, so why not do it among friends and food? You can give your book club a theme (reading only female authors or re-reading the classics) or you can all just throw your favorite book titles in a hat and draw one out every month. It’s a great way to explore titles you may never have even thought to read before.

Host a book swap.

Image result for book swap

These parties are so fun! Get some wine and cheese and gather up your favorite used books. Tell your friends to come with their favorites and have fun exchanging titles.

Read a book with a movie counterpart.

Image result for book vs. movie gif

Sometimes the inspiration you need to start or finish a book lies in the ability to watch the movie version when you’re done. Read a book before its movie hits screens in 2018 (you can see a list of those here) and have fun telling your friends how the book was waaaaay better.

If you don’t like it, stop reading it.

Image result for throwing book gif

This is a hard lesson for readers to learn, but one worth mentioning. There are so many good books in the world and there’s no use wasting time trying to read a book you don’t like. I usually give a book one chapter or 20 pages, whatever comes first, to grab my attention. If I’m not interested, I move on. No shame, no guilt. You’ve got to find what you like!

23 Fun Facts about Zooey Deschanel

Zooey Claire Deschanel was named after Zooey Glass, the male protagonist of J.D. Salinger’s 1961 novella, Franny and Zooey.

Zooey’s father is an Academy Award-nominated cinematographer Caleb Deschanel and her mother is the actress Mary Jo Deschanel, who starred in Twin Peaks. Her older sister, Emily Deschanel, also starred in Bones.

Image result for Deschanel family

She attended Crossroads prep school, along with fellow actors Jake Gyllenhaal and Kate Hudson.

Image result for zooey deschanel kate hudson

Don’t let Jessica Day fool you…She’s also a very talented tap dancer. She took lessons for 6 years.

new girl dance GIF

Her first acting role was as a model on the TV show, Veronica’s Closet, which also starred Kirstie Alley.

Image result for zooey deschanel veronica's closet

She also attended Northwestern University for nine months before dropping out to become an actress.

But it wasn’t until Almost Famous that Zooey became, well, famous. She was cast alongside her pal, Kate Hudson, as Anita Miller, the protagonist’s rebellious older sister.

Image result for zooey deschanel almost famous

Then Elf happened. After her part as a deadpan department store worker, Zooey was in hot demand. Everyone wanted her to play the sarcastic “best friend”, a typecast she didn’t feel she owned since she’d stay home from school all the time and didn’t have many friends growing up.

youre weird zooey deschanel GIF

Speaking of Elf, Zooey does all her own singing in the film.

zooey deschanel shower GIF

She’s also a very talented musician and can play a multitude of instruments, including piano, guitar, and ukulele. She is also in a band called She & Him alongside Mathew Ward.

cameron crowe GIF

One of her favorite singers of all time is Ella Fitzgerald, which shows with her trademark raspy voice.

For her role as Jessica Day on New Girl, Zooey has received one Emmy and three Golden Globe nominations.
